About Christa McAuliffe Academy

Christa McAuliffe Academy is located at 2302 N Coronado St, Wichita, Kansas, in the northeast Wichita area, and serves students in grades PK to 8. The school enrolls about 847 students with a student-teacher ratio close to 14 to 1. Around 23 percent of students meet math proficiency, and about 28 percent meet reading proficiency. The student body consists of approximately equal representation, with about 50 percent male and 50 percent female students. Christa McAuliffe Academy welcomed Kansas native and NASA astronaut Brigadier General Nick Hague in September 2025. He spoke to students about his space missions and emphasized the importance of STEM education, inspiring young learners to dream big.
